
The accounting industry regulator revokes the registration of a New York-based firm
The Public Company Accounting Oversight Board took action against a public accounting firm for the first time since the PCAOB was created in 2003.
The accounting sheriff revoked the registration of New York-based Goldstein and Morris CPAs P.C. and barred its managing partner, Edward B. Morris, from associating with a registered accounting firm. The PCAOB found that the firm concealed information from the board and submitted false information in connection with a PCAOB inspection.
